Hey guys! Thanks for the compliments.

Disclaimer: As far as the bling, I do have to say that part of what you are seeing is the flash from the camera. I think my hair does reflect the light and in pictures, it appears extra shiny. It's always had that effect no matter what I use. I just don't want to make it seem like everyone will have the same effect if you use the same product.

That said - I do use this for leave-in and it does smooth my hair and make it shine - it is old school and I've been using it for over 15 years

ic.jpg


Then, I use some kind of butter/creme. I change products. I used to use MyHoneychild's Caribbean Hair Creme and still like it
carribeancreme.jpg


but I you guys sold me on Qhemet Biologic and I'm on the bandwagon now. My current favorite is Burdock Root and Alma and Olive Heavy Cream.

When I do twist/twistouts, I either use KCCC (if I want hold), njoicreations Herbal Styling Pudding (soft and bouncy), or EcoStyler (in between KCCC and Herbal Styling Pudding).

I wash with CON or cowash 2 times a week and DC when I can. Almost always have hair up and/or curly.

That's it guys. Sorry I don't have any big secrets!

Did you BC or transition?

I forgot to answer the bolded.
I went natural 2x once in the 80s in high school , went to college and relaxed (now I know that I texalaxed because I still wore my hair exactly the same way only it had less bulk). Second time was when I went to grad school and had no money and stopped relaxing. I didn't do a bc (didn't know what that was) but I stopped relaxing, went for my regular trims until I was natural. Not sure exactly how long that took because I never really had straight ends but after 2-3 years of not relaxing and cutting off ends, I considered myself natural. I've had really short hair and long hair throughout the last 15 years of being natural. Only in the last year have I focused on healthy length.
